Model Evolution and Rare Editions

The Mercedes S-Class story traces back to the flagship Mercedes-Benz 220 of the 1950s. In addition, each era upgraded its chassis, engine, and luxury features. By the 1970s, the “S-Class” badge represented the summit of Mercedes-Benz luxury.

Over time, each generation introduced signature innovations. For example, the 1991 W140 brought double-glazed windows and soft-close doors. The W221 stunned markets in 2005 with radar-driven adaptive cruise control. However, it’s the rare editions—such as the AMG-tuned S 65 with its hand-built V12—that truly fire the collector’s imagination.

Performance Pedigree: Beyond Comfortable Cruising

While most S-Class owners buy this car for its comfort, the performance numbers are always world-class. For example, today’s S 580 delivers a 0-100 km/h time under 5 seconds thanks to its twin-turbo V8. This is supercar territory, achieved with near-silent luxury.

Meanwhile, even the plug-in hybrid S 580e blends electric power with a turbocharged inline-six. In addition, buyers can opt for AMG packages, which push performance to even higher levels. The S 63 AMG E PERFORMANCE combines V8 muscle with hybrid drive, achieving 802 horsepower and eye-watering torque.

  • V8 Biturbo engine in S 580
  • S 580e Plug-in Hybrid for sustainability
  • AMG S 63 E PERFORMANCE for sports sedan thrills
  • Air suspension and E-ACTIVE BODY CONTROL options
  • 4MATIC all-wheel drive for supreme agility

Thus, no matter your preference, the S-Class lineup offers performance to match any mood.

Interior Craftsmanship and Cutting-Edge Technology

No other sedan rivals the S-Class for sheer cabin luxury. Every surface blends fine materials, from quilted Nappa leather to open-grain wood trim. Meanwhile, Mercedes sets the tech agenda with the latest MBUX infotainment system and OLED displays.

Moreover, the rear seats offer heated, ventilated, and massaging comforts. You’ll also find executive rear seating that effortlessly outclasses any rival. For example, Burmester 4D sound and active mood lighting set the scene for a first-class journey. In addition, the S-Class features Level 3 semi-autonomous driving technology in select regions.

  1. Heated, massaging, ventilated seats
  2. Executive lounge seating available
  3. MBUX augmented reality navigation
  4. Burmester 4D premium audio
  5. Advanced active safety and driver assist

Consequently, every ride in the S-Class feels bespoke and indulgent.

Comparison with Rivals

The Mercedes S-Class has always set the benchmark. However, flagship rivals such as the BMW 7 Series and Audi A8 pose real competition. For example, Audi offers tech-forward interiors and quattro all-wheel drive. Meanwhile, BMW emphasizes driving engagement, especially in V8 and V12 trims.

In contrast, the S-Class consistently wins in terms of overall ambiance and brand cachet. Furthermore, Maybach models move the conversation toward Rolls-Royce and Bentley in terms of pure opulence. Thus, the S-Class manages to outshine its competitors on both comfort and technology.

Collector Appeal and Resale Value

Some S-Class models turn into coveted collectibles. For example, the W140 coupe and V12 sedans from the 90s have surged in value among enthusiasts. In addition, rare AMG editions like the S 65 or S 63 E PERFORMANCE gain attention for their supercar engines in luxury disguises.

Meanwhile, strong resale values make the S-Class a smart buy for the long haul. Mercedes owners often enjoy excellent aftersales support. Moreover, Maybach editions stand out for exclusivity and prestige factors, which helps keep their resale prices strong.
